[edit] People

大田 (Ōta) is a Japanese surname, not to be confused with 太田 (Ōta)

  • Hiroko Ōta (大田 弘子), a female Japanese politician and a researcher of economics
  • Masahide Ota (大田 昌秀), a former governor of Okinawa Prefecture, Japan, in the 1990s
  • Nanami Ohta (大田 ななみ), a Japanese actress
  • Ōta Nampo (大田 南畝), a late Edo period Japanese poet and fiction writer
  • Princess Ōta (大田皇女), the eldest daughter of Emperor Tenji of Japan, in the Asuka Period
